    they want right aroud 200 for the axels... not the ugly tube ones either... the repro ibeams... guess they look pretty good... you just have to grind off the S logo on the front and you are good 2 go.

    bp
     
  6. Magnum is the exact same thing without the S. You can get the SuperBell in forged aluminum(like 9-lbs or something) for $800, but you can get the Magnum in a larger variety of perch and kingpin widths.
